Sam is standing atop Dacula Mountain, the highest point in the area, 156 meters above sea level. Kendall is standing in Florida valley at the lowest point in Florida, at 4 meters above sea level. What is the difference in elevation between where Sam and Kendall are standing?

A. 152 meters
B. 160 meters
C. 160 meters below sea level
D. 152 meters below sea level

1 Answer

4 votes

Final answer:

The elevation difference between Sam's location on Dacula Mountain and Kendall's location in Florida valley is 152 meters, calculated by subtracting Kendall's elevation from Sam's elevation.

Step-by-step explanation:

The difference in elevation between where Sam and Kendall are standing can be found by subtracting the elevation of the lower point from the elevation of the higher point. Sam is at an elevation of 156 meters above sea level while Kendall is at an elevation of 4 meters above sea level. Therefore, the difference in their elevation is:

156 meters (Sam's elevation) - 4 meters (Kendall's elevation) = 152 meters

The correct answer is A. 152 meters.
